Native Casino App vs Mobile Browser Casino: Which Is Better?
A native casino app in the UK typically performs better when you play regularly. It loads faster once installed, and it lets you log in with Face ID or a fingerprint instead of typing a password every time. If you'd rather skip the download, save your phone's storage, or just don't want another app cluttering your home screen, playing through your browser works just as well.
Here’s a quick overview of how each option works, so you can decide how you want to access your preferred mobile casino in the UK.
Native App
A native app can cache interface files and ensure you remain signed in securely. But the part that most players don't realise is that many casino games still run via HTML5. So, while the lobby feels snappier, individual game loading times are often much the same either way.
Let's get into a few things worth knowing about iPhone and Android casino apps.
Android
- You can only download apps through Google Play or the casino’s verified website.
- Don’t sideload APK files you find through search results, adverts, or messages, as modified installers could put your login and payment details at risk
- Check that the app includes the full casino instead of the platform’s sportsbook only
iOS
- You’ll find that UK real-money casino apps are distributed via Apple’s App Store
- Face ID and Touch ID are great for reducing login friction without storing your password openly
- Apple’s review restrictions mean some online casinos offer browser play without an iOS app
Browser Play
Playing through your browser means no updates to install and no storage taken up on your phone, which makes it a solid choice if you're a casual player who dips in now and then.
The one thing to watch for is that some UK slots sites reserve certain slots, live tables, or promos for app users only, so it's worth comparing the lobby and bonus terms on both sites before you settle on one.
Pro Tip
Browser play always loads the casino’s latest platform version, so you avoid the compatibility issues caused by an outdated app.
Mobile-Exclusive Bonuses for UK Players
The promotions you’re most likely to find on the best casino apps in the UK include app-only rewards, standard welcome offers for all punters, and free spins.
Since January 2026, wagering requirements can’t exceed 10x the bonus funds. UK rules also state that one promo can’t combine rewards from different gambling products.

Welcome Bonuses
Almost every real-money casino app has a welcome package, although the value can vary significantly. For example, at Swift Casino, you get a 100% matched deposit bonus worth up to £75 along with 50 free spins. By contrast, Skybet offers 50 free spins at £0.10 apiece, although there are no wagering requirements on the winnings.

Free Spins
Apart from receiving spins within a welcome package, you’ll also find this bonus as a standalone promotion. At The Online Casino, a £20+ deposit on Wednesdays gives you the chance to win between 5 and 500 free spins randomly. Before claiming this type of offer, find out the per-spin value, as there’s a big difference between 50 spins worth £0.10 each and 30 spins valued at £0.50 apiece

No Deposit Bonuses
It’s challenging to find online mobile casinos in the UK with no deposit bonuses. That said, some platforms provide app-exclusive offers such as £5 in free credit or 20 free spins. While the rollover must remain at 10x the value of the bonus or winnings, you can expect a low maximum withdrawal limit.

Cashback
With this bonus, you receive a percentage of your net losses back over a specific period, usually on wagering from Monday to Sunday. At the best mobile casinos, you may see a 10% cashback offer, so if you lose £50 during the week on qualifying bets, you get £5 back, usually with no wagering requirements.

VIP and Loyalty Bonuses
UK rules require enhanced controls around high-value customer programmes. As such, VIP schemes are less generous than they used to be. A typical loyalty scheme will issue points based on how much you bet or reward you for completing missions. From there, you convert the points into perks such as free spins or bonus credit.
Pro Tip
Calculate the wagering requirements before claiming a bonus to see if you can realistically complete them in time. For example, you must make £750 worth of bets if you receive a 100% bonus worth £75 with a 10x rollover. If the expiry period is less than seven days and the max stake per bet is low, completing the wagering requirement may prove difficult.
Payment Methods for Casino Apps UK
At our recommended mobile casinos, e-wallets, mobile payments, debit cards, and bank transfers are supported in your app. The top platforms make it easy to deposit or withdraw in a couple of taps, with instant deposits and same-day payouts providing unrivalled convenience.

E-Wallets
We found P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ller readily available at most of the best casino apps. While you get instant deposits, payout speeds can vary, although fast withdrawal casinos in the UK can process transactions in a couple of hours. You may also see PaysafeCard, a prepaid deposit option that’s great for privacy but isn’t available as a withdrawal method.

Apple Pay & Google Pay
You’re more likely to find Apple Pay instead of Google Pay on mobile casino sites. Depending on your device, you can authorise payments via Face ID, Touch ID, or fingerprint verification without entering your card number into the app. The downside is that most platforms don’t support either option for payouts, so you’ll need to find an alternative method.

Pay by Phone Bill
When you use pay by phone to fund your account, the deposit gets added to your monthly phone bill or deducted from your prepaid balance. Popular options such as PayViaPhone and Boku offer convenient on-the-go top-ups. However, deposit size is limited, you need a different withdrawal method, and you have to contend with potentially substantial processing fees.

Debit Cards
Whether you use Android or iPhone casinos, you should have the option of using Visa and Mastercard debit cards for deposits and withdrawals. This payment option offers instant, easy deposits and straightforward payouts, although it can take 1-3 working days for the money to reach your account. Credit card payments have been banned at UK-licensed gambling sites since April 2020.

Bank Transfers
This is the slowest option, with withdrawals taking several working days if you go down the traditional route. Some casino apps UK support Rapid Transfer, which integrates with the UK’s Faster Payments network. Payouts could be processed on the same day if your casino account is fully verified.

Cryptocurrency
Strict regulations mean that domestically licensed platforms won’t permit UK residents to gamble with cryptocurrency. There are tentative plans to work towards accepting digital currencies at online casinos, though it’s unlikely to happen any time soon.

Responsible Gambling Tools
UK casino apps are restricted to players aged 18+. In addition, all UKGC-licensed gambling sites must participate in GamStop, the national online self-exclusion scheme. Once you register, you’re unable to access any participating operators for your chosen exclusion period.
Domestically licensed casinos must provide a variety of responsible gambling tools. You can set deposit or loss limits, activate session time reminders and reality checks, or take a temporary time out within your account. These controls work best when you configure them before you start betting.
If gambling is causing concern, you can reach out to GamCare or the free, 24-hour National Gambling Helpline at 0808 8020 133. GambleAware is another option, as it offers a support finder, self-assessment tools, and guidance on gambling-blocking software.
